Pete storms to victory... Past Captain Pete Wilson obviously picked up some good tips while helping out as he stormed to victory last Saturday in the August Stableford. He scored 40 points even with a penalty shot on the 16th hole due to hitting himself with his ball! Ian Botterill was second with 39 points with a fine 22 points on the back nine. Stuart Santon continues a really solid season winning Division one with 38 points, playing the back nine in two under par. It was a Callaway Apex 1-2 in Division one as Richard Brown was second, with both Richard and Stuart having been fitted for new Callaway irons this year.
